Critical metals, including lithium, cobalt, and nickel, are indispensable in the fabrication of batteries, particularly those used in electric vehicles and renewable energy storage solutions. Their unique properties make them irreplaceable in many high-tech applications, from smartphones to satellites. In addition to their economic and environmental importance, critical metals also hold a geopolitical significance. As countries vie for technological superiority and energy independence, having access to these resources could dictate the pace and direction of their development.
